A video compression system and method for compressing video data by reducing the temporal redundancy in the video data is described. A block of video data is divided into a variable number of blocks of pixel data of varying size. Each block of data is compared to a window of pixel data in a reference frame of pixel data by means of a motion vector calculator (82a-82d). A distortion figure is computed for each block of video data in distortion calculators (84a-84d). These distortion figures are then summed and weighted by means of distortion summing elements (86b-86d) and weighting factor multiplying elements (88a-c) respectively. The weighted summed distortion values are then compared against one another in comparators (90a-c), the results of which determine the way in which the block of video data is divided in motion vector selector elements (106, 108, 110). Only the residual difference, the displacement vectors and an indication of the block sizes used in the prediction are needed for transmission or storage. |
